Importing ColdFusion .car files into Lucee 5

What’s the most efficient way to import Adobe ColdFusion 9 Settings like
Server settings, Scheduled Tasks, DSN’s, Mappings, etc. into Lucee 5? I was
hoping for compatibility with a .car file (ColdFusion Archive), but haven’t
found anything of that nature in the docs or Google for that matter. Does
Lucee do that? If not, hasn’t anyone ever suggested such a thing? That
seems like 101 for switching CFML apps from Adobe ColdFusion to Lucee.

CAR files have a weird format, but it can be done. Those settings are also stored in the various neo-*.XML files in cfusion/lib. ACF when installing new versions will actually detect older versions installed and will try to migrate settings automatically. Perhaps the same could be done for Lucee.
